你查询的IP:[59.172.14.236]  地理位置:中国–湖北–武汉电信

最新查询124.249.65.59 119.254.40.218 124.67.16.178 117.106.53.44 202.90.150.12 121.48.163.80 59.64.158.126 117.100.22.43 221.176.21.51 59.172.14.236 222.64.143.196 59.191.229.42 119.27.160.71 117.60.127.158 202.192.51.64 118.230.147.7 202.164.189.242 58.240.220.159 210.79.224.113 202.148.96.175 202.96.162.227 203.174.96.132 117.120.64.135 221.199.192.211 117.122.128.236 202.22.248.77 117.76.66.121 203.18.50.43 116.199.128.150 124.112.247.162 202.136.224.159